Does anyone know of such a place? > >And while we're on the topic, please send in names of hamlets or >neighborhoods that are not on our list. Names like Dingman Point (where >I grew up) or Elm Flats (where my husband went to school) are found on >few maps, and are quite unknown to people not living in that particular >township, even in the same county. If your ancestor lived at DeLaFarge >Corners, we know she was somewhere close to LaFargeville, but certainly >not in the metropolis! We pass through Scoville Corners, Seven Bridges, >and Gunns Corners on every trip Watertown before we reach Depauville, and >turn off for Clayton Center. > >For instance, Three Mile Creek Cemetery is NOT Three Mile Bay cemetery >for which I was corrected recently. > >Let's see what we can do!
